Why is android 17 low tier?
I dont understand why many players are placing him at the bottom tier..? I had no problem playing with him, he is fast and mix up heavy, his forward stance is at least good but you do not depend on it. His back and forth dash can be cancelable, which can translate to super dash, vanish and plus frame. He has android 18 fast ki blast. He has a sliding kick which is good vs reflect players.He got Air super,down super ssj3 behind the back, and strong level 3.

so your opinion?

Dokainin Dec 15, 2018 @ 5:09am 
some of the worst normals in the game. multiple hugely telegraphed gaps in his blockstrings that need assists to cover. Low damage out of anything started from his rekka mix. possibly the worst neutral in the game due to his lack of meaningful projectiles, unsafe movement options and terrible buttons. As well as having one of if not the worst assist in the game and a cinematic side switching level 1 which greatly limits DHC synergy. And his post lvl 3 setup is nothing special.

Basically for him to be a viable character in any serious manner of play he needs 3 assists... 1 for neutral to let him actually find a way to approach, 1 for combos to get past his low damage, and 1 to enable his pressure.... and even if that were possible his rekka is inferior mix to any character with a special that leaves them airborne and it makes him extremeley linear which translates to being predictable.

he is definitively the worst character in the game... which sucks. And Arcsys has to figure out how to fix what is the worst designed character on the roster when none of the obvious fixes would make much of a difference at all.

But with that said if you wanna play him then play him. Unless your goal is to win tournaments Tier Lists are largely meaningless.
